Tank deformations are normally caused by large amounts of fuel being added <br /> Into an underground tank. Allow adequate time for the product to be delivered and the <br /> subsequent stabilization of the tank. <br /> Amount of Product to be Delivered Before Precision Tank Test <br /> 75% - 90% of tank volume capacity 20 - 36 hours <br /> 50% - 75% of tank volume capacity 14 - 20 hours <br /> 25% - 50% of tank volume capacity 8 - 14 hours <br /> 5% - 25% of tank volume capacity 6 - 8 hours <br /> Note- USTest protocol suggests delivering large amounts of fuel 2 days In advance of the test <br /> and continuous fuel top off until test date. <br />
